Engineering Project Manager - Kiewit Power Engineering

Kiewit is a full-service consulting and engineering firm serving the infrastructure and engineering markets. They are seeking an Engineering Project Manager to oversee internal design teams, manage project schedules and budgets, and ensure effective communication between design and construction leadership.

Responsibilities

Overall management of the internal project design team(s)
Has a detailed understanding of all contractual obligations for the project to ensure contract design requirements are met
Facilitates effective communication between design and construction project leadership
Communicates project design and performance status with Clients and permitting agencies
Ensures proper coordination of technical details across multiple engineering disciplines
Supports Business Development activities including RFP reviews, proposals, project estimates, engineering fee estimates, etc
Resolves conflicts that arise through partnering with design team, clients, and construction
Supports construction priorities and ensures their implementation through the design
Plans and communicates needs for Kiewit Engineering resources to support projects
Manages and interprets data and results for multiple projects
Responsible for meeting project engineering schedules and budgets
Identifies current and future risks along with mitigation strategies
Consolidates best practices from project execution
